GPAT 2026 Application Edit Window to Open on January 16

GPAT 2026 Application Edit Window: The National Board of Examinations in Medical Sciences (NBEMS) will activate the GPAT application form edit window 2026 on January 16, 2026. Candidates who have paid their GPAT application fees and submitted the application form before the last date will be eligible to edit the GPAT application form 2026, as per their requirements. The last date of editing the GPAT 2026 application form is January 19, 2026. Candidates should miss the deadline for editing the GPAT application form, since the authority will not extend the last date of closing the application form correction window. Note that the authority will also not accept any fresh registration during this period.

GPAT 2026 Registration Ends on January 12

GPAT 2026 Registration: The registration process for the Graduate Pharmacy Aptitude Test (GPAT) 2026 is coming to an end, and the National Board of Examinations in Medical Sciences (NBEMS) has announced that the online application form for the exam can be submitted only till January 12, 2026.  B. Pharma holders and final-year B. Pharma students in the country are eligible to apply through the official portal, NBEMS. The GPAT Exam, 2026, is scheduled to be conducted on March 7, 2026, in Computer-Based (Online) mode, which shall enable eligible candidates to compete for seats in the premier pharmacy institutes.

KCET B.Pharm Exam Pattern 2026: Check Question Distribution, Marking Scheme, Total Marks, Duration

One of the first crucial stages for candidates is to comprehend the exam pattern, which outlines the format, number of questions, subjects covered, marking system, and duration of each session. Candidates who are familiar with this pattern are better able to organize their study and approach the test with confidence and clarity. The KCET B.Pharm examination is conducted in offline mode (pen and paper based) using an OMR answer sheet. The test includes multiple choice questions (MCQs), each with four alternatives, from core science subjects. For Pharmacy aspirants, the relevant subjects are Physics, Chemistry, and an elective choice between Mathematics or Biology. Each subject paper carries 60 questions, and each correct answer earns 1 mark, making the total of 180 marks for the three subjects combined. Importantly, there is no negative marking, so candidates are encouraged to attempt all questions they are confident about, without the fear of losing marks for incorrect answers. The duration allotted for each subject paper is 1 hour and 20 minutes (80 minutes), creating focused time blocks for answering questions from individual subjects. Dear student,

The Institute of Pharmacy Kalyani offers a D.Pharm course for its students. D.Pharm is a two-year diploma course. The Institute of Pharmacy Kalyani is approved by the Pharmacy Council of India (PCI) for offering a D.Pharm course. The approval is extended up to 2025-2026 academic sessions. The yearly approved intake for D.Pharm at the Institute of Pharmacy Kalyani is 60 students.
